Michaels Memorial BRP Mod Tour $3000 to Win Set for Saturday, July 19th, Plus IMCA Racesaver 305s, DIRT 602 Crate Mods, and SCDRA Mini Stocks.
By Jim Balentine (Mercer, PA)
This Saturday, July 19, 2025, Michaels Mercer Raceway presented by Sunbelt Rentals will honor the Michaels family, who are in their 6th year of their 2nd tenure of ownership at the historic speedway, with the BRP Modified Tour paying $3000 to win.
Our regular divisions, the IMCA Racesaver 305 Sprints, Top Shelf Trucking DIRT 602 Crate Sportsman, and the Kings Forestry Products SCDRA Mini Stocks, will also highlight the card.
The Michaels family has been involved in racing since the 1970s, with patriarch Howard owning cars that ran at Mercer throughout the years. Howard and the family were instrumental in rebuilding the race track in 1994 after it was left dormant following the 1989 racing season. They sold the track after the 1996 season, and son Harold Michaels competed in the small block modified/big block modified division for many years.
After the Michaels family sold the track for the 1997 season to Gary Butch and his family, both Howard Michaels and his sons, Howard Jr. and Harold, passed away. Harold passed away in 2002; Howard Sr. passed away in June 2007 following a motor vehicle accident; and Howard E. Michaels passed away in April 2019. In 2019, Howard’s son Ed, along with his brother Earl, repurchased the facility and continues the rich tradition at the historic speedway.
